Senior Facilities Manager




As a senior-level professional, you'll oversee the integral delivery of IFM services on a major site or group of sites across within a country. In doing so you will optimize operational efficiency, ensure regulatory compliance, and build strong relationships with key stakeholders, including operations teams, vendors, landlords, and J&J personnel. If you're an experienced facilities management leader with office and manufacturing expertise looking for a role that offers growth, autonomy, and the chance to make a real impact across a diverse property portfolio, this opportunity is perfect for you!

Some of your day as a Senior Facilities Manager:



Manage all Soft Services within the facilities,

ensuring compliant and satisfactory delivery of cleaning, catering, pest control, landscaping, reception, mail & logistics, workplace and occupancy management and light duty maintenance services across the buildings within your scope. Where relevant, making sure the GxP rules are being adhered to.

Manage assigned

assets within the

facilities,

ensuring a safe, productive, and professional work environment across assigned building systems that could include HVAC, plumbing, electrical, lighting, janitorial, and grounds

Maintain and enhance preventative maintenance programs

to minimize equipment failures, maximize operational efficiency, and prevent unplanned downtime through proper servicing

Utilize CMMS systems

to schedule, track, and manage work orders while ensuring timely maintenance and issue resolution

Perform repair/replace analytics

and decision-making for building infrastructure and mechanical systems, analysing maintenance outliers to determine root causes and direct appropriate action

Prepare,

submit

, and manage facility budgets

aligned with organizational goals, tracking variances, capital budgets, R&M spend, and G&A expenditures while overseeing procurement of supplies and equipment

Identify

, qualify, select, and develop national/regional vendors

for repairs and scheduled maintenance programs while growing and managing contractor relationships

Monitor vendor performance

and manage warranties and compliance of work performed, understanding all contracts to ensure delivery of services as agreed upon

On request, l

ead and coordinate facility renovation projects

with minimal disruption to production processes and act as a field contact for problem resolution with landlords or property managers

Ensure compliance

with portfolio-wide initiatives and required local, state, and federal laws/regulations while developing safety protocols and partnering with QA and EH&S for regulatory compliance. Make sure both internal and outsourced staff are properly trained and SOPs are being followed.

Lead and develop a team

of Facility Management professionals, building actionable career development plans and participating in compensation planning processes

Build and

maintain

effective relationships

with third-party owners, landlords, IT, HR, and other departments while providing consistent communication to national/regional leadership on all projects
